Full Job Description
The Role

This position is a hybrid role that combines responsibilities in diagnostic medical physics support and health physics / radiation safety. The successful candidate will work under the direction of qualified medical physicists to support hospitals, imaging centers, and outpatient facilities throughout the NYC metropolitan area.

The role will include assisting with diagnostic imaging equipment performance evaluations, supporting radiation protection programs, conducting quality assurance testing, assisting with nuclear medicine audits, reviewing radiation safety documentation, and helping ensure compliance with applicable NYC, New York State, Joint Commission, ACR, and institutional requirements.

This is an excellent opportunity for someone looking to grow within the medical physics and radiation safety field while gaining hands-on experience across a broad range of clinical environments.

What You'll Do
  • Perform diagnostic imaging equipment evaluations under the supervision of a qualified medical physicist, including computed tomography, radiographic, fluoroscopic, dental, and lead apron testing.
  • Conduct quality assurance testing to verify that equipment is operating safely, accurately, and in compliance with applicable standards.
  • Maintain detailed records of equipment performance, maintenance, repairs, quality assurance results, and regulatory documentation for review by senior physicists.
  • Assist with nuclear medicine quarterly audits and inspections of radiation safety programs.
  • Support compliance with NYC Department of Health, New York State, Joint Commission, ACR, and institutional radiation safety requirements.
  • Assist with the development, implementation, and review of Radiation Protection Programs and related procedures for medical clients.
  • Attend Radiation Safety Committee meetings for hospital-based clients, as needed.
  • Assist with monitoring, analyzing, and interpreting occupational radiation dosimetry data.
  • Help prepare consultation reports and corrective action recommendations for exposures exceeding ALARA thresholds.
  • Support incident response activities involving potential or actual radiation exposure, contamination, or loss of radioactive material.
  • Work closely with Radiation Safety Officers, regulatory agencies, physicists, and operational staff.
  • Perform additional duties as assigned.
